随笔分类 -  数论

摘要:http://poj.org/problem?id=3347边长不等的正方形,互不相交的摆放在x轴上,且边长与x轴y轴成45度角。(具体可以看题目图例)要注意正方形的顶点不能越过y轴。很麻烦的一道几何道,必须要对边长扩大sqrt(2)倍化整数,来避免精度问题。求每个正方形在x轴上的区间:若正方形i与正方形i-1相邻,则可直接计算出正方形i的顶点位置x。不相邻的话就要依次让正方形i与0~i-1的正方形相邻求出相应的顶点位置x,取最大值。#include<stdio.h>#include<stdlib.h>#include<iostream>#include&l 阅读全文
posted @ 2011-05-04 15:23 CoderZhuang 阅读(191) 评论(0) 推荐(0)
摘要:http://162.105.81.212/JudgeOnline/problem?id=1222题意:有一个5*6的方阵,每个位置都表示按钮和灯,1表示亮,0表示灭。每当按下(i,j)时,(i,j)和(i-1,j)、(i+1,j)、(i,j-1)(i,j+1)都会改变,亮的变灭,灭的变亮;问在这样的一个方阵中按下哪些按钮可以把整个方阵都变成灭的,这时1表示按了,0表示没按。此题也可以用枚举来写:http://iiacm.net/2010/07/pku-1222-extended-lights-out/转载分析:这个游戏的名字叫做Lights Out。一个板子上面有MxN个按钮,按钮也是灯。每 阅读全文
posted @ 2010-11-01 22:38 CoderZhuang 阅读(195) 评论(0) 推荐(0)